Magento の認証情報を使用して Invision Community にログインする | Magento を IDP として使用する Invision Community でのシングル サインオン (SSO)
概要
Magentoのユーザー認証情報を使用してInvision Communityにログインします。このガイドは、Magentoをアイデンティティプロバイダー(IdP)として、Invision Communityをサービスプロバイダー(SP)として統合する方法を説明します。 miniOrange Magento IDP(アイデンティティプロバイダー)拡張機能. IDP としての Magento 拡張機能を使用すると、Magentoの認証情報を使用してInvision Community(SP)にログインできるようになります。ここでは、MagentoとInvision Community間のSSOを設定するための手順をステップバイステップで説明します。 インビジョンコミュニティのSPとして (サービスプロバイダー)および IDP としての Magento (アイデンティティプロバイダー)。
インストール手順
- コンポーザの使用
- 手動インストール
構成手順
ステップ1. Invision CommunityをOAuthクライアントとして構成する
- コミュニティ ドメインのバックエンド管理コントロール パネル (https:// .invisionservice.com/admin) にアクセスしてログインします。
- ダッシュボードで、 左側のパネル -> 設定 をクリックします。入力したコードが正しければ、MFAの設定は正常に完了します ログイン&登録.
- ソフトウェアの制限をクリック 新しく作る ボタンをクリックして新しいメソッドを作成します。
- 選択する その他のOAuth 2.0 ハンドラーとしてクリックします 続ける.
- コピー リダイレクト/コールバック URL (赤いボックスで強調表示されています)、OAuth サーバーを構成するときに必要になります。
- あなたは 外観の設定 の三脚と アカウントマネジメント 要件に応じて設定を行います。 クリック Save 一度終わった。
ステップ 2. Magento を OAuth サーバーとして構成します。
- miniOrange IDP 拡張子、に移動します 用途 タブには何も表示されないことに注意してください。
- 選択する OAuth/OpenID アプリケーションメニューから。
- 検索する インビジョンコミュニティ アプリケーションの選択検索ボックスでアプリケーションを選択します。
- 入力する OAuth クライアント名 as インビジョンコミュニティ
- 貼り付け リダイレクトURL 以前にコピーされた リダイレクトURL フィールド。
- Enter openid メール プロファイル スコープフィールドで 保存 変更。
- に移動します 用途 タブをクリックして 編集 アプリケーションの設定
- あなたは、 顧客ID の三脚と クライアントシークレット 自動的に生成されます。コピーして手元に置いてください。
- 貼り付け 顧客ID の三脚と クライアントシークレット Invision コミュニティで。
- Magento IDP拡張機能に戻り、 詳細 Magento OAuthエンドポイントを取得するためのリンク
- ここでは、 Endpoints 必要に応じてコピーしてください。
- 貼り付け Endpoints Invision Communityのエンドポイントフィールドでクリックします 仕上げ 構成を保存します。
ステップ3. 属性マッピング (これはプレミアム機能です)
- ミニオレンジ Magento IDP 拡張子をクリックして、 用途 タブをクリックして 編集 アプリケーションの設定。
- OAuth サーバーに送信する属性名を追加し、ドロップダウン メニューから属性を選択します。
- ソフトウェアの制限をクリック 属性を追加 OAuthクライアントに送信したい属性名を追加し、ドロップダウンメニューから属性を選択してクリックします。 保存ボタン 変更を保存する。
OAuth クライアントとしての Invision Community と OAuth サーバーとしての Magento 間の SSO が正常に構成されました。
関連記事
Get in Touch
までご連絡ください magentosupport@xecurify.com、Magento IDP拡張機能の設定を弊社チームがサポートいたします。お客様のご要望に応じて、最適なソリューション/プランの選定をお手伝いいたします。
